If your identity documents (passport, ID card, driver's license) are about to expire or have already expired, you must update your Binance KYC information as soon as possible. Otherwise, your account will be restricted to "Withdrawal Only" mode, and you will not be able to deposit, trade, or perform other operations. Binance provides a clear document update process; once submitted and approved, your account will be restored.

Prerequisites

Before starting the document update process, confirm the following:

  1. You hold a valid document: The new document must already be in your possession. If the old one has expired and the new one hasn't arrived yet, you cannot proceed.

  2. You can log in to your Binance account normally: You need to be able to receive verification codes on your registered email and phone.

  3. The account is currently in normal status: It is not frozen or under risk control.

Step 1: Access the "Update Identity Verification" Page

What to do: After logging in, go to the identity verification settings page and find the document update entry.

How to do it:

Option A: Via the web platform

  1. Log in to the Binance official website.

  2. Hover over the profile icon in the top right corner and click [Account].

  3. Go to the [Identity Verification] page and find "Update Identity Information" or a similar button.

Option B: Via the App

  1. Log in to the Binance App.

  2. Tap the user avatar icon on the top left of the home screen to enter account information.

  3. Go to [Verification] or [Identity Verification] and tap [Update Identity Information].

If you cannot find the update entry on the page, you can send "How to update Identity Verification" to online customer service. The reply will include a link to reset your KYC.

What indicates completion: You have entered the "Update Identity Verification" flow, seeing a drop-down menu or reason options.

Step 2: Select the Update Reason and Confirm the Declaration

What to do: On the update page, choose the reason for the document update, read and agree to Binance's declaration terms.

How to do it:

  1. Select the reason that applies to you from the drop-down menu. Common options include:

    • "The documents have expired"

    • "The name on the document has changed"

    • "The document number has changed"

  2. Carefully read the declaration on the page and check [I have read and agree to this declaration].

  3. Click [Confirm Update].

As soon as you click confirm, Binance will immediately switch your account to "Withdrawal Only" mode. Until all new documents are submitted and approved, you will not be able to trade, deposit, etc. Please have your new documents and photo materials ready before starting.

Step 3: Fill in the Updated Identity Information and Upload New Documents

What to do: Enter the information from your new document and upload clear photos.

How to do it:

  1. Fill in the updated identity information: name, document number, date of issuance, expiration date, etc. Make sure all the content you enter matches the original new document exactly, including capitalization and spaces in the pinyin name.

  2. Select the document type (ID card, passport, driver's license) and the issuing country/region.

  3. Follow the prompts to take or upload clear photos of the front and back of the new document.

Photo requirements:

  • All four corners of the document must be fully in the frame, with no information obscured

  • No glare, no shadows, clean background

  • Text must be clear and legible

  • Do not use re-photographed images or screenshots; the photo must be of the original document

What indicates completion: All new information is filled in, new document photos are uploaded successfully, and you click [Continue] to submit.

Step 4: Wait for Review and Confirm the Result

What to do: After submission, the Binance review team will process your application. You need to wait for the review result.

How to do it:

  • During the review, the account remains in "Withdrawal Only" status.

  • Once approved, Binance will send a notification email to your registered email address.

  • After receiving the notification, log in and go back to the [Identity Verification] page to confirm that the verification status has returned to "Verified".

What indicates completion: You have received the approval email from Binance and account functions are restored.

Common reasons for rejection:

  • Unclear photos of the new document, information covered or obstructed by glare.

  • The name or document number entered does not match the original (e.g., an extra space in the pinyin name).

  • The uploaded document type was selected incorrectly (e.g., selecting ID card but actually uploading a passport).

FAQ

Q1: What happens if I don't update my documents?

Binance will restrict the account functions. From the moment you submit the update request until it is approved, the account will also be limited to "Withdrawal Only" mode. If you have existing orders, you can close and cancel them, but you cannot open new positions.

Q2: How long does the review take?

There is no official uniform review time. The review may take varying amounts of time depending on application volume. It is recommended to submit the update at least 1-2 weeks before the document expires to avoid affecting normal trading.

Q3: If my update application is rejected, can I submit again?

Yes. You can submit up to 10 times per day. If you are rejected 10 times within 24 hours, you need to wait 24 hours before trying again. After a rejection, carefully check photo quality and information consistency before retrying.
